How to Make Your Dishwasher Last Longer

On February 25, 2026  By newsroom   Topic: Appliance Buyers Guide

A well-maintained dishwasher can last up to 10 years or more! Follow these expert-backed tips to keep it running efficiently and cleaning effectively for years to come.


1. Scrape, Don’t Rinse

  • Remove bones, toothpicks, and solid debris to prevent clogs and pump damage.
  • Skip pre-rinsing; modern dishwashers are designed to handle dirty dishes.

2. Clean the Filter Regularly

  • How: Remove the bottom rack, unscrew the filter, and rinse under warm water.
  • Frequency: Monthly, or more often if dishes feel gritty.
  • Tip: Replace damaged filters immediately to prevent pump damage.

3. Wipe the Door Seal

  • Use white vinegar and a cloth to clean the rubber door seal as needed.
  • Avoid harsh chemicals, bleach wipes, or scouring pads to prevent damage.

4. Remove Hard-Water Residue

  • Use a citric-acid-based cleaner (e.g., Affresh or Finish) monthly to clear mineral buildup.
  • For hard-water areas, add regeneration salt to your dishwasher's water-softening system to prevent spotting and mineral accumulation.

5. Check Spray Arms

  • Inspect spray nozzles every few months and remove food debris with a toothpick or pipe cleaner.
  • Remove spray arms to clean if necessary, using a screwdriver for the upper arm.

6. Rustproof Racks

  • Repair worn plastic coatings with vinyl paint or replacement tine tips to avoid corrosion.
  • Prevent rust flakes from damaging the pump and causing expensive repairs.

7. Avoid Overloading

  • Overloading restricts water spray and prevents proper cleaning.
  • Running partial loads frequently also wears out mechanical parts prematurely.

8. Stick to Dishes Only

  • Don’t wash greasy car parts, waxy candlesticks, or other non-dish items.
  • Non-food debris can clog filters, damage pumps, and reduce performance.

Cleaning Tip: Wash Your Dishwasher!

  • Food particles and grease can build up over time, causing odors.
  • Run an empty cycle with a dishwasher cleaner or white vinegar every few months to keep it fresh.
